pub struct MaxCutProblem {
pub n_vertices: usize,
pub edges: Vec<(usize, usize, f64)>,
}Expand description
Weighted MaxCut problem instance.
The MaxCut cost function is: C = Σ_{(i,j)∈E} w_{ij} * (1 - ⟨Z_i Z_j⟩) / 2
Fields§
§n_vertices: usizeNumber of vertices
edges: Vec<(usize, usize, f64)>Weighted edges: (vertex_i, vertex_j, weight)

Sourcepub fn cost_function(&self, state: &Statevector) -> QcResult<f64>
pub fn cost_function(&self, state: &Statevector) -> QcResult<f64>
Compute the cost function value: C = Σ w_ij * (1 - ⟨Z_i Z_j⟩) / 2
This is the expected number of edges in the cut, which we want to maximize.
